Transaction 29c31f9114db0f4609e5a71b8227cd8042bd609a66aed40106676d7435d4b5a5
1 Input
1 Output
-
29c31f9114db0f4609e5a71b8227cd8042bd609a66aed40106676d7435d4b5a5: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 de575c63d3576f98ded48bc2182f1679c58b5ec59e6a773e6d33c2b4802d9b7b
- address
- bc1pmet4cc7n2ahe3hk530ppstck08zckhk9ne48w0ndx0ptfqpdndasej7lzs